BIOGRAPHY

Luis Rego, born on May 30, 1943, is a multifaceted French actor and comedian of Portuguese descent, celebrated for his vibrant contributions to film and comedy. He gained fame as a founding member of the iconic music/comedy group Les Charlots, which set the stage for his diverse career in entertainment. Among his notable works, his performance in "Mauvaise Blague" (2022) stands out, captivating audiences with its unique blend of humor and poignant storytelling. What genres has Luis Rego worked in throughout his career?

Luis Rego has worked in a variety of genres including comedy, drama, TV movies, documentaries, adventure, and romance.

During which decade was Luis Rego most active in film?

Luis Rego was most active in the 2000s, appearing in many films throughout that decade.

What is one of Luis Rego's notable early film roles?

One of Luis Rego's notable early roles was Georges "Bobo" Pelletier in the 1978 comedy French Fried Vacation.

Has Luis Rego appeared in any films recently?

Yes, Luis Rego has appeared in recent films such as Mauvaise Blague (2022) and Meet the Leroys (2024).
